Rebranding

Jaguar is scheduled to unveil a new concept car previewing its next-generation electric vehicle on December 2nd. The company is about to enter a new era with the introduction of the long-awaited electric GT.

The next-generation concept was previously reported to be unveiled at the end of the year. This time, in JLR’s (Jaguar Land Rover) second quarter financial results announcement, it was revealed that the project will be announced as the “next stage in Jaguar’s transformation” at the art fair “Miami Art Week” that will open in the United States. Jaguar recently ended sales of new cars in the UK as it transitions to the next generation of models.

The concept car showcases Jaguar’s new design language, which will be featured in the next-generation lineup of three cars: a four-door GT, a Bentley Bentayga-like SUV, and a Bentley Flying Spur-class sedan.

All three models are based on the long-wheelbase JEA platform developed exclusively for Jaguar.

The 4-door GT has a cruising range of over 690km and a maximum output of over 580ps. Prices are expected to start at around 100,000 pounds (approximately 20 million yen).

Jaguar managing director Rawdon Glover recently told Autocar that the decision to show the concept car in the United States was due to the importance of that market, but the brand’s origins He added that he was not taking this lightly.

“That doesn’t mean Britishness isn’t important. It’s a very important part of the brand. But Jaguar is also a global brand. Look at the size of the US market. It’s very important to us.”

In August of this year, JLR announced that it had begun test driving a prototype of the next generation Jaguar car. The GT is scheduled to go on sale in the second half of 2025, with deliveries starting in the summer of 2026.

Jaguar recently ended production of the F-Pace for its home market in the UK and halted all new car sales. However, it is still on sale in other regions.

A statement from JLR to the Autocar UK editorial board said:

“From November 2024 onwards, Jaguar new car sales will end ahead of the new brand launch at the end of this year and product launch in 2026.”

“We have now finished allocating current generation Jaguar vehicles. There are models available as certified pre-owned vehicles through Jaguar’s UK sales network.”

JLR CEO Adrian Mardell said production of the F-Pace for global markets will end in the first quarter of 2026.
